Output e625862c1110c4c24376aaeae8ee81578a767ae83aa6d575b27b52c5a86915e5:312

value
4686
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e66845304e4d9e3da29797b82deb3fb9fd7484bf49af3d50f876ba9f59c07c9d
address
tb1pue5y2vzwfk0rmg5hj7uzm6elh87hfp9lfxhn658cw6af7kwq0jws9z8083
transaction
e625862c1110c4c24376aaeae8ee81578a767ae83aa6d575b27b52c5a86915e5